The BA Creative Writing is a unique and exciting programme of study that gives students the opportunity to explore a range of disciplines, from prose fiction to poetry, scriptwriting to creative non-fiction. Under the tutelage of practising published, award-winning writers with a reputation for excellence in their field, you will not only build an understanding of the craft of writing and hone their authorial technique, students will also learn the vital instinct for reading as a writer. Through practical projects and engagement with visiting professionals, students will broaden their understanding of the many aspects of the writing industry. Students will also complete an extended creative project in a specific genre in their final year. Graduates can pursue careers in creative writing, journalism, education or media production. This degree may also be useful in becoming an author, journalist, higher education lecturer or screenwriter.
